Software Developer | UI

ROHDE & SCHWARZ GmbH & Co. KG
7 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English, German

Job location

Remote

Tech stack

Testing (Software)
Microsoft Windows
Automation of Tests
Unit Testing
C++
Continuous Integration
Software Debugging
Linux
Graphical User Interface
Design of User Interfaces
Python
Object-Oriented Software Development
QT
Gitlab
GIT
Information Technology
Software Version Control

Job description

  • Develop and implement the graphical user interface (GUI) for our oscilloscopes, including the design and implementation of controls and dependencies for measurement parameters.
  • Responsibility for usability and user experience.
  • Define work packages, and provide time and cost estimates.
  • Perform software tests (unit test and simulation) including error analysis.
  • Contribute to the development of the base system and test frameworks using C++.
  • Collaboration on product expansion and product maintenance.

Exciting insights into Rohde & Schwarz

Our colleagues provide insider information about:

  • Daily adventures and challenges
  • Our passionate team
  • The technologies behind the innovative projects and solutions

Requirements

  • Completed degree in Electrical Engineering, Information Technology, Computer Science, or a comparable field of study.
  • Proven expertise in object-oriented software development with C++ (>= C++17).
  • Proven expertise in UI/UX design and modern priciples. Experience with a common GUI framework, ideally Qt / QtQuick (>= Qt6).
  • Practical experience with software testing methodologies (e.g. with python, squish, ...).
  • Good knowledge of tools for continuous integration (e.g. gitlab) and software version control (git).
  • Practical experience developing and debugging software on both, Windows and Linux environments.
  • Structured, independent working style combined with a team-oriented approach.
  • Fluent German and English language skills, both spoken and written.

About the company

Rohde & Schwarz is a global technology company with approximately 14,000 employees and three divisions: Test & Measurement, Technology Systems and Networks & Cybersecurity. For 90 years, the company has been developing cutting-edge technology, pushing the boundaries of what is technically possible and enabling customers from various sectors such as business, government and public authorities to maintain their technological sovereignty. Telecommunications 10,001 or more employees München, Germany 3.9 Based on 1,237 reviews Flexitime Work from home Canteen Restaurant tickets Childcare Company pension Accessibility Health in the workplace Company doctor Training Car park Convenient transport links Employee benefits Company car Mobile device Profit-sharing Staff events Private internet use Dogs welcome, 1237 employees at Rohde & Schwarz have rated their company's corporate culture as being slightly modern. This is in line with the industry average.

Apply for this position